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ll begin by assessing the damage and creating a customized plan to restore your garage.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ify potential safety hazards.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action and preventing further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Next, our technicians will use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ract the standing water from your garage. This step is critical in preventing further damage and ensuring your garage is safe to enter.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is extracted, our technicians will use desiccants and air movers to dry out your garage.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ring your garage is safe to use.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Finally, our technicians will clean and sanitize your garage to remove any remaining moisture and prevent future damage. This step is essential in ensuring your garage is safe and healthy to use.

Garage Water Removal Cost In Camp Wood, TX
The cost of garage water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Camp Wood,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for common garage water removal services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the amount of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the level of contamination |
| Structural rep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the structural damage and the materials needed for repair |
| Roof repair or replacement | $1,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the roof damage and the materials needed for repair or replacement |
| Mold rem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the level of contamination |
